They practically did it… Al Gore is the forty-fifth Vice President and noted Democratic icon of the United States of America who served under Bill Clinton from 1993 to 2001. Recently, he has made a donation of $750,000 to the Alliance for Climate Protection, a non-profit advocacy group which he founded to fight global warming. The image that your business card design and logo design present of your brand identity is very important. It establishes your attitude and reflects your business. Firstly, your business card design establishes your relationships with clients and would-be clients, which can eventually make your business a success. With a bit of creativity, you can turn these ordinary materials into magnetic marketing tools that will play a vital role in keeping the mill running.
